P2 - Serial

This is a 9 pin D-type serial input/output connector
to control via an RS 232 or RS 485 connection the
TV 1001.

RS 232/RS 485 COMMUNICATION
DESCRIPTION
Both the RS 232 and the RS 485 interfaces are
available on the connector P2.
The communication protocol is the same (see the
structure below), but only the RS 485 manages the
address field. Therefore to enable the RS 485 is
necessary to select the type of communication as
well as the device address by means of the T-Plus
software.

Communication Format

8 data bit
no parity
1 stop bit
baud rate: 600/1200/2400/4800/9600 programma-
ble

Communication Protocol

The communication protocol is a MASTER/SLAVE
type where:
Host = MASTER
Controller = SLAVE
The communication is performed in the following
way:
the host (MASTER) send a MESSAGE + CRC to
the controller (SLAVE);
the controller answer with an ANSWER + CRC to
the host.
The MESSAGE is a string with the following format:
<STX>+<ADDR>+<WIN>+<COM>+<DATA>+<ETX>+<CRC>
where:
When a data is indicated between two quotes ('...')
it means that the indicated data is the correspond-
ing ASCII character.
<STX> (Start of transmission) = 0x02
<ADDR> (Unit address) = 0x80 (for RS 232)
<ADDR> (Unit address) = 0x80 + device num-
ber (0 to 31) (for RS 485)
<WIN> (Window) = a string of 3 numeric char-
acter indicating the window number (from '000'
to '999'); for the meaning of each window see
the relevant paragraph.
<COM> (Command) = 0x30 to read the win-
dow, 0x31 to write into the window
